How they compare
Latin America and the Caribbean currently reports 212,260 kt against 9,644 kt in United Republic of Tanzania, a difference of 202,616 kt.
That makes Latin America and the Caribbean's figure about 22.0 times United Republic of Tanzania's.
Across all 34 years both countries report, Latin America and the Caribbean has been ahead every year.
Latin America and the Caribbean ranks 8th and United Republic of Tanzania ranks 27th of 33 groups.
Latin America and the Caribbean has averaged higher in every one of the 4 decades both report.

About this data
The FAOSTAT domain on Emissions Totals summarizes the greenhouse gas (GHG) emissions disseminated in the FAOSTAT Climate Change domains of emissions from agrifood systems. Data are computed following the Tier 1 methods of the Intergovernmental Panel on Climate Change (IPCC) Guidelines for National greenhouse gas (GHG) Inventories (IPCC, 1996; 1997; 2000; 2002; 2006; 2014). Emissions from other economic sectors as defined by the IPCC are also disseminated in the domain for completeness.
